Bridge in Lhuentse collapses a day ahead of completion

January 28, 2013
in Uncategorized
Reading Time: 1 min read
0
0
SHARES
2
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

langchenphuZamcollaspesThe Langchenphu bridge in Lhuentse collapsed one day prior to its completion. The 140 feet long bridge gave way on the January 15 after the launching nose of the bridge broke. Only one worker at the site suffered a hand fracture, the rest escaped unhurt.

The launching nose is said to have broken as it had been old.

The bridge is being built by the Construction Development Corporation Limited (CDCL). CDCL officials have said, in their defence, that except for the launching nose, they have been following proper construction norms. The CDCL Regional office in Lingmithang has built 15 bridges, so far, and this bridge is the first one to collapse. The CDCL hopes to have the bridge complete in a little over a week’s time.

The bridge, when complete, will connect the remote villages of Kurtoe Gewog.
